Broussard, David & Moroux is a top personal injury law firm based in downtown Lafayette with offices in Greater New Orleans that offers potential for advancement, annual salary increases, holiday bonuses, generous holiday schedule and competitive benefits for employees. We are currently seeking an experienced Personal Injury Paralegal to join our legal team in the Lafayette office. The ideal candidate will have excellent organizational skills, a passion for helping others, and the ability to work independently in a fast-paced environment.
Responsibilities
- Assist attorneys in all aspects of personal injury cases
- Manage and organize case files
- Communicate with clients, witnesses, and opposing counsel
- Prepare discovery requests and responses, letters, and requests for documents (including medical records)
- Schedule and coordinate depositions, mediations, court appearances, and client meetings
- Other relevant responsibilities, as necessary
